Text

Except as otherwise provided in this chapter, all rules applicable to the former Workers' Compensation Commission are hereby adopted and made effective as to the operation of the Workers' Compensation insurance market to the extent that they are not in conflict with the current law. Authority to enforce the existing rules and the regulatory functions of the commission as set forth in chapter twenty-three of the code shall transfer from the commission to the Insurance Commissioner effective upon termination of the commission.
